Every year workplaces, schools, early learning services, community groups, reconciliation groups, and people right across the country host a range of activities and events during National Reconciliation Week (NRW).
The dates for NRW are the same each year: 27 May to 3 June. Look through the calendar to see how you can mark NRW at an event near you.

Tennis Victoria’s Reconciliation Round is a celebration of connection, culture and community. Bringing together players, volunteers and supporters from tennis clubs across Victoria, the event recognises and celebrates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ander peoples, cultures and histories while encouraging meaningful conversations and actions toward reconciliation.
Held as part of the Pennant Super Round (across two venues) the day will feature Welcome to Country, smoking ceremony and didge performance (12:15pm) and opportunities for participants to learn, reflect and engage with the themes of National Reconciliation Week. The event aims to create welcoming and inclusive tennis environments where everyone feels a sense of belonging.
Through sport, Tennis Victoria is committed to strengthening relationships, fostering respect and creating opportunities for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ander peoples to participate and thrive in tennis and community sport. The Reconciliation Round highlights the role sport can play in bringing people together and advancing reconciliation in action.
